Bonds Releases ‘Killer Undies’ With AFL Superstar Dustin Martin

Clothing brand Bonds has recruited Richmond Tigers star Dustin Martin to headline as its new underwear ambassador in a powerful stills and video campaign that launches this week.

Martin champions Bonds’ latest men’s underwear range by showcasing his athletic physique and signature ink against the iconic Bonds underwear silhouette.

The new fashion and sports underwear collection features a palette of cool, toned patterns, camo prints and textured waist bands.

Dustin Martin wearing Bonds undies

Complementing the campaign, Martin stars in a fun digital video campaign.

The 30-second clip, ‘Killer Undies’, captures the AFL player sprinting through the suburban streets of Melbourne in his Bonds undies chasing his puppy ‘Killer’.

Showcasing Martin’s athletic prowess, the clip sees the explosive Richmond midfielder leaping over fences and fending-off garbage men in only his Bonds undies while in pursuit of his runaway dog.

Emily Small, head of marketing at Bonds, said: “Dustin is not only a star athlete, but a real originator – he does things his way and people relate to that. We’ve had fun creating our content collaboratively and are delighted to be working together.”

Martin said: “I’ve grown up with Bonds, and when they approached me, it felt a natural fit. It’s an iconic and authentic brand which I relate to, as they wanted to collaborate on the campaign.

“It ended up with me running around Melbourne streets in my underwear, which was a first!”
